Gibson ES-335 Walnut 1971

The following specs were carefully collected and recorded by a skilled technician. For a more detailed description and questions regarding sound, feel, or cosmetic condition, please call to speak to one of our experts.

Summary

Finish: There are two touchups on the back of the neck, which appear to be repaired cracks. There is also finish blushing/hazing on the front, side, and back of the treble bout.

Body Material: Maple

Top Material: Maple

Neck Material: Mahogany

Neck Profile: "C" profile

Neck Thickness (IN): .78" (1st fret), .98" (12th fret)

Fingerboard Radius: 12.00"

Nut Width: 1-9/16"

Scale Length: 24 3/4"

Electronics: Original Gibson humbuckers with patent number stickers, and original wiring harness. The pot codes are mostly obscured, but appear to date to 1971.

Pickup Measurements: 7.5k (neck), 7.5k (bridge)

Hardware: Original

Weight: 7 lbs 14 oz

Cosmetic Condition: This vintage Gibson ES-335 shows mostly light signs of aging and wear, with light scratches and marks throughout the glossy finish. There is a repaired crack at the bridge tone pot, and there is finish hazing and checking in the surrounding areas. This appears to be from water. There are two touchups on the back of the neck, which appear to be repaired cracks.

Modifications/Repairs: There are two touched up and repaired cracks on the back of the neck. There is also a repaired crack at the bridge tone pot.

Serial Number: 771988

Tech Notes: The guitar plays well with low action, and the frets show mild play wear. The serial number and appointments date the guitar to 1971.

Case Details: Original Chipboard Case. The case shows warping from water.
